1. Which of the following impellers is not an example of axial flow impeller?
a) Propeller
b) Hydrofoils
c) Pitched turbines
d) Ruston
View Answer

Answer: d
Explanation: Ruston is a radial flow impeller. The classification of impeller depends on the angle that the blade makes with the plane of impeller rotation.

3. Which of the following combination of the flow pattern can be observed in an open turbine?
a) Radial only
b) Axial only
c) Radial and axial
d) Mixed
View Answer

Answer: c
Explanation: In an open turbine both radial and axial flow can be observed, whereas in propellers only axial type of flow pattern can be observed. And in equipment like shrouded turbines and paddles axial flow pattern can be observed. The presence of both the flow patterns in an open turbine makes it advantageous over other equipment.

5. Which of the following impeller is best suited in mixing operation in lead, rubber and plastics?
a) Propeller – marine
b) Flat blade turbine
c) Anchor
d) Paddle
View Answer

Answer: b
Explanation: In case of lead, rubber and plastics they require high intensity solid scrubbing which is primarily provided by flat blade turbines. These are used for blending when high shear is required.

8. Agitation and Mixing are synonymous.
a) True
b) False
View Answer

Answer: b
Explanation: Mixing is a physical process of distribution of particles which can be performed in any desired manner that is randomly, whereas agitation is a physical process of distribution of particles involving a particular circular motion. Also generally mixing is used for creating a homogenous phase whereas agitation is usually used for the purpose of separation.

9. Baffles are often used to reduce tangential motion of fluid.
a) True
b) False
View Answer

Answer: a
Explanation: The impeller causes the liquid to circulate through the vessel and eventually return to the impeller, which leads to vortex formation. In order to avoid the vortex formation baffles are used.

10. In Propeller the angle that the blade makes with the plane of impeller rotation is _____
a) Greater than 180
b) Between 90 to 180
c) Less than 90
d) Between 145 to 200
View Answer

Answer: c
Explanation: The design of propeller is constructed such that the angle that the blade makes with the plane of impeller rotation is less than 90. The proper angle of impellers allows for effective pumping and bulk mixing with strong axial velocities and low power consumption.
